Title: modern horror miniatures? (that aren't horrorclix)
Post by: Shadowdragon on November 12, 2018, 02:51:13 AM
There doesn't seem to be a section for modern miniatures so I thought I'd try asking here. Does anyone know of a line of modern horror miniatures that would work for games like Chronicles of Darkness? Something that has modern vampires, werewolves, etc usable as both villains and characters? I'm hoping to find something other than the awful Horrorclix minis from Wizkids.

There is also the Road Kill range from West Wind - lots of vampires and werewolves and other modern horror types, often on motorbikes!

https://www.westwindproductions.co.uk/index.php?route=product/category&path=192_73

If you are US based, they are also available from Old Glory.

The sculpts are showing their age a bit, and apparently some of the biker ones are a nightmare to put together, but they would be a good starting point.

Pulp City has a number of modern werewolf-ish types, like Moonchild (http://newstore.pulp-city.com/index.php?route=product/product&path=59&product_id=64), Loup Garou II (http://newstore.pulp-city.com/index.php?route=product/product&path=59&product_id=113), Bigfoot (http://newstore.pulp-city.com/index.php?route=product/product&path=59&product_id=204) and Zombie Wolf (http://newstore.pulp-city.com/index.php?route=product/product&path=59&product_id=154), though they're more to the 30mm scale.

Some more suitably big (though naked and unarmed) half-form werewolves from North Star, here (http://www.northstarfigures.com/prod.php?prod=8927) and here (http://www.northstarfigures.com/prod.php?prod=11549), as well as wolves (http://www.northstarfigures.com/prod.php?prod=10402).

Otherworld Miniatures make a werewolf (https://otherworldminiatures.co.uk/shop/wilderness-encounters-2/we7c-werewolf/), wolves (https://otherworldminiatures.co.uk/shop/wilderness-encounters-2/we8a-wolves-4-2/) and dire wolves (https://otherworldminiatures.co.uk/shop/wilderness-encounters-2/we8b-dire-wolves-2-2/) as well.

For modern Nosferatu types, Black Cat Bases has a line of ghouls in hoodies (http://blackcatbases.com/product-category/figures/figures-ghouls/) charging with improvised weapons, crawling out of sewers and, less generally helpfully, riding bicycles.

(The long out of production official miniatures for the World Of Darkness (http://www.miniatures-workshop.com/lostminiswiki/index.php?title=Category:White_Wolf) include various armed werewolves among other things, which you might be able to find on eBay, and Chronicles Of Darkness has all of five official miniatures for the Vampire: The Requiem board game Prince Of The City (https://boardgamegeek.com/boardgame/13456/vampire-prince-city).)
